Some
eagle-eyed cataloguers may have noticed that the NUC now contains a few RDA
records. These records were created in OCLC's WorldCat during the US National
Libraries testing of RDA and have been downloaded to the NUC as part of
standard cataloguing activities.
While
RDA is still in its pre-implementation phase the National Library is not
planning any changes to these records. The reasons for this are:
1.
There are relatively few RDA records in the NUC at present and there is no
reason to believe that they will cause problems for New Zealand libraries
2.
International decisions around RDA implementation are imminent and making
changes to records at this stage could mean that other work would be needed
later. The records are easily identifiable should they need to be altered.
If
RDA records are an issue in your local system then please change the records in
your system only.
